Thunderbolts* Director Jake Schreier on emotion, stunts and throwing Florence Pugh off a building
Thunderbolts*, sorry, The New Avengers, helmed by Emmy winner Jake Schreier, is a bona fide hit both critically and financially. With a cast of characters who don’t exactly scream “Avengers material”: Yelena Belova, Bucky Barnes, Red Guardian, Ghost, Taskmaster, and John Walker, have become lovable losers who have endeared themselves to audiences. ‘Thunderbolts’ Director Was Inspired by His Own Work With Kendrick Lamar and Baby Keem
Thunderbolts director Jake Schreier recently explained how his early work with Kendrick Lamar and Baby Keem inspired his approach to making the Marvel blockbuster.
